When life splits into before and after, everything changes. The air feels different. Time moves strange. You keep breathing — but you're not the same person anymore.

That's where grief begins. In this deeply personal episode, Kate McKay, author, high-performance coach, and founder of the Grief and Grace series, shares what really happens to us — physically, mentally, spiritually, and relationally — when the heart breaks open.

Grief isn't something we "get over." It's something that gets into us. It reshapes the body, rewires the mind, and cracks the soul open to a deeper kind of grace. 💫

You'll Learn:

How grief affects your body, mind, and spirit

Why you feel exhausted, foggy, or disconnected (and why that's normal)

What grace actually looks like when you're in survival mode

How to begin rebuilding your strength and sense of self 🕊️
